The first round of political consultations between the Ministries of Foreign Affairs of the United Arab Emirates and the Slovak Republic took place in Bratislava on 4 December 2025, co-chaired by Lana Zaki Nusseibeh, Minister of State, and Marek Eštok, State Secretary at the Ministry of Foreign and European Affairs.
Following the recent visit of Prime Minister Robert Fico to Abu Dhabi, the consultations reaffirmed the strength of the bilateral partnership. Both sides discussed ways to enhance cooperation across multiple sectors, with particular emphasis on boosting trade, unlocking investment opportunities, and exploring civilian nuclear energy collaboration.
The parties also noted the significant growth in non-oil bilateral trade, which rose by one-third to exceed USD 1 billion in 2024, alongside increased bilateral foreign direct investment flows.
The discussions included a comprehensive exchange on regional and international developments, covering issues in the Middle East and Europe.
The consultations underscored the importance of ongoing dialogue to address regional challenges and support international stability. Both sides reaffirmed their commitment to holding regular consultations to advance shared goals for the benefit of their citizens.
